3. The Crash Journey: Step‑by‑Step Mechanics Explained

Chicken Road’s gameplay unfolds in four distinct phases:

  • Betting Phase: Place your wager and select a difficulty level.
  • Crossing Phase: Watch the chicken hop across tiles; each hop is a step toward higher multipliers.
  • Decision Phase: After each safe step, decide whether to continue or cash out.
  • Resolution Phase: If you cash out, you win; if not and a trap appears, you lose everything.

The difficulty range—Easy (24 steps) to Hardcore (15 steps)—directly influences how quickly the multiplier escalates and how much risk you take per round.
